The Goods and Services Tax (GST) Council on Wednesday deferred its decision on revising rates for under-construction real estate.
The next meeting will be held on February 24.
Finance Minister Arun Jaitley said few ministers expressed their opinions during the meeting through video conferencing. "The rest will express their opinions on Sunday, and we will try and arrive at a decision," he said. "I have always followed an approach of moving forward on consensus."
In its final recommendations on real estate submitted on Monday, a Group of Ministers headed by Gujarat Deputy Chief Minister Nitin Patel had favoured lowering GST rates on under-construction houses from 12 per cent with input tax credit to 5 per cent without input tax credit.
Similarly, it had suggested reducing the rate for under-construction affordable houses to 3 per cent without input tax credit from 8 per cent.
